BAZAN MILLS ARE THE LARGEST EXPORTERS OF SUGAR VIA CONTAINER IN 2024

After a considerable increase in 2023, sugar exports via containers remained relatively stable in 2024, with an annual increase of 1.4%. The commodity is still more profitable for sugar and ethanol companies than ethanol, which resulted in a record shipments last year, with 38.24 million tons . In addition to Brazil’s high production, with mills betting on crystallization to take advantage of the good moment in prices, the global context was favorable. The Indian government, with low prospects for the country’s harvest, did not allow exports in 2024. Thus, the Brazilian product became even more prominent in the global market. Brazil exported 2.98 million tons of sugar via containers last year, 8% of the total sent to other countries. 168 companies exported Brazilian sugar via containers in 2024 and mills Bazan were the largest exporters.
